Answer:

x=13

y= -9

(13, -9)

Step-by-step explanation:

If we are solving using the substitution method, we can take the first equation and set it to y so y=4-x.

Then, we can take that equation and plug it into the bottom one so

3x+4(4-x)=3

Simplify:

3x+16-4x=3

-x=-13

x=13

We can then plug 13 into any of the two given equations (I am just going to plug it into the top one)

So, 13+y=4 which y= -9
